Artist Bio:
Tony Bennett is an American singer, best known for his jazz and traditional pop music. He was born Anthony Dominick Benedetto on August 3, 1926, in Queens, New York. Bennett began his singing career in the late 1940s and gained popularity in the 1950s with hits like "I Left My Heart in San Francisco" and "Rags to Riches."


Throughout his career, Bennett has received numerous awards and accolades, including 19 Grammy Awards, including a Lifetime Achievement Award. He is also a visual artist, with his artwork displayed in galleries around the world. Bennett is known for his smooth voice, impeccable phrasing, and timeless style, making him a beloved figure in the music industry. He continues to perform and record music well into his 90s, showcasing his enduring talent and passion for the arts.
